- [ ] Step 7: Archive cold storage buckets (Glacierline tier). Confirm both ceremony witnesses are present, verify bucket manifests match the Oxbow ledger, then seal the archive key shares. Plugin authors may observe but not handle shares. Once sealed, the archive index itself is encrypted and can only be reopened with the passphrase below.

vault phrase of badup-hahig = tamael-aldael-kelmir-istael-fenok-istwyn-tamius-jorath-oliion

Finance Review Summary — Customer Concentration, Verelux Group

Revenue concentration remains elevated: the Dunmoor account represents 31% of recurring income, up from 26% last year. Two further accounts together add 18%. Contract renewal timing clusters in the second quarter, compounding exposure. Heads of department should factor this into hiring and inventory commitments. Mitigation options are under review, and the confidential note below sets out the plan.

internal memo for faweg-hahip: Silokix Works plans to lower the Tamvan list price by 8 percent in June.

## Step 3: Shard cutover

Before splitting the Lumenfolk profile store, verify replication lag is under one second on every replica and freeze schema migrations. Run the shard-map generator twice and diff the outputs; any mismatch means stale topology and you must stop. Once the maps agree, stage the router with the values below.

settings of tagef-bawif:
DRUIX_HOST=druix.zemvarlabs.internal
DRUIX_PORT=8000

Handover for the Stockweave reconciliation job: nightly run now compares warehouse counts against the Ledgerline snapshot and writes discrepancies to the review queue. Two known false positives remain for bundled SKUs; a fix ships next sprint. Release manager should hold the cutover until the queue is clear. Ongoing ownership transfers to the engineer below.

named custodian: Fraion Holael